Description

The ATLAS III Reporting Working Group will make analysis of the feedback collected from participants.

ATLAS III Brainstorming Commitments Ideas (Located at the end of the document)

  1. Engaging and participating in WGs

  2. Giving feedback to the RALO about the participation and engagement

  3. Reviewing the ROP for participation and finding ways to improve them

  4. Creating a document of shared experiences gained during ATLAS3

  5. Planning to hold joint APRALO outreach events across all individuals and ALSes

  6. Increasing local community to engage and outreach

  7. Holding joint webinars across the community

  8. Increasing participation to the CPWG & Monthly Calls

  9. Becoming more visible and effective participants

  10. Becoming liaisons for communications on behalf of ICANN to each of their National internet community

  11. Creating interest groups for discussion such as IPR, Cybersecurity

  12. C the IGFs, ALSes, ICANN multi-stakeholder approach, and ICANN outreach will be promoted

  13. Everything said will be in a one-pager, that is to reaffirm the commitments, and to be shared with At-Large

  14. Each ALS will take action to communicate ICANN’s vision and mission outside of ICANN

  15. Making sure of engagement and inclusion from gender and indigenous groups

    Communicating ICANNs work within the ALSes

  16. Committing senior members to become mentors to 2-3 ALSes in the region

  17. Committing each member regularly to participate one or more monthly meetings or WG sessions

  18. Picking a specific area of interest within At Large among active topics

  19. Using the topic and leverage active participation within At-Large
